Subject: [PATCH] Mark correct aha152x driver (PCMCIA) as !64BIT

As Matthew Wilcox pointed out - the ISA aha152x driver was already marked
as ISA only, so couldn't have been enabled on x86-64.
The warning I saw was actually for the PCMCIA aha152x driver.
Mark that one as !64BIT
--- linux-2.5-cleanup/drivers/scsi/pcmcia/Kconfig-o 2003-09-28 06:33:48.000000000 +0200
+++ linux-2.5-cleanup/drivers/scsi/pcmcia/Kconfig 2003-12-02 18:15:03.414452576 +0100
@@ -7,7 +7,7 @@
config PCMCIA_AHA152X
tristate "Adaptec AHA152X PCMCIA support"
- depends on m
+ depends on m && !64BIT
help
Say Y here if you intend to attach this type of PCMCIA SCSI host
adapter to your computer.
